A fantastic opportunity to acquire a modern, bright and spacious 3-bed flat in a desirable area in Kennington. EPC rating B
Upon entering the property on the ground floor, you are welcomed by a spacious hallway which gives access to all rooms and provides a practical sense of separation between the living and sleeping areas.
To the right is the open-plan kitchen and reception room, a bright and sociable space that works well for both day-to-day living and entertaining. The kitchen is fitted with integrated appliances including an induction hob with extractor fan, oven, microwave, and fridge freezer. There is plenty of worktop space along with a good range of cupboards for storage. The reception area has ample room for a sofa, dining table, and additional furniture, while the floor-to-ceiling windows bring in lots of natural light. A door opens directly onto the terrace, making the room feel even more spacious.
Off the hallway is the family bathroom, finished in a modern style and comprising a bath with shower above, wash basin, mirror, and W.C.
There are three bedrooms, all well sized and able to accommodate double beds along with freestanding furniture. Each room enjoys an outlook over the terrace and communal gardens, giving a pleasant and peaceful aspect. The main bedroom also benefits from built-in storage and an en-suite shower room with shower, W.C., wash basin, and mirror.
Outside, the private terrace is a real feature of the property and provides an excellent space for sitting out, dining, or enjoying the warmer months.

Location: Lollard Street is located just off Gibson Road. The development is moments from the River Thames and close to Kennington Cross with its vibrant mix of shops, cafes, bars and restaurants.
Directions: Vauxhall Overground, Underground and Bus Stations (Victoria Line & National Rail) are approximately 0.6 miles away. Lambeth North Underground Station (Bakerloo Line) is approximately 0.6 miles away and Kennington Underground Station (Northern Line) is also approximately 0.7 miles away.
